Decentralized Storage & Data Networks - Internet of Things (IoT) Integration - Related Software Technologies

IoT Integration for Smart Operations in Software Systems

Modern frontend development has evolved into a strategic differentiator for digital businesses, far beyond good-looking interfaces. Today, organizations demand fast, reliable, and data-rich web experiences that seamlessly integrate with complex backends and analytics. In this article, we will explore how React-based dashboards, design systems, and expert consulting come together to build scalable, maintainable, and truly business-driven front-end platforms.

Modern Frontend Architecture and React Dashboards as a Business Engine

In the last decade, frontend development has undergone a dramatic transformation. What used to be a thin presentation layer is now a sophisticated application tier in its own right, responsible for state management, data visualization, offline behavior, access control, and even parts of business logic. At the heart of this shift is React, which has become the de facto standard for building complex, component-driven user interfaces.

From a business perspective, the primary purpose of modern frontend architecture is to turn raw data and backend capabilities into useful, actionable experiences. Dashboards are one of the clearest expressions of this goal: they transform metrics, KPIs, and events into a navigable, interactive environment that decision-makers can use daily.

When organizations consider Modern Frontend Development and ReactJS Dashboards for Business, they are not just choosing a technology stack; they are choosing a way of thinking about products. React encourages modularity, reusability, and composability. These traits are not merely technical niceties. They are how businesses achieve:

  • Faster feature delivery through reusable components and well-structured design systems.
  • Lower long-term costs via maintainable codebases and clearer separation of concerns.
  • Consistent user experience across many pages, apps, or even brands.
  • Better data-driven decisions made possible by real-time, interactive dashboards.

To understand why React-based dashboards have become central for many businesses, it helps to break down the core attributes that define a modern frontend architecture.

Componentization as a Business Asset

React’s component model maps surprisingly well to business concepts. Each visual module (for example, a revenue chart, a user profile card, or a notification panel) can be encapsulated as a component with clear APIs for data and behavior. When properly designed, these components can be reused across multiple dashboards, products, and even teams.

This componentization enables:

  • Design system enforcement: UI and UX consistency is stabilized because all teams consume the same base components.
  • Rapid experimentation: Teams can assemble new views by composing existing components, allowing quick A/B testing and feature trials.
  • Easier onboarding: New developers learn a predictable, structured codebase with recognizable building blocks.

In practical terms, a single investment in a high-quality data table, filter panel, or graph component can pay dividends across an entire organization. When built with accessibility and performance in mind, these components help you scale both from a user and a developer perspective.

State Management and Data Flows as Strategic Capabilities

Dashboards are only as valuable as the data they can represent. A modern React architecture takes state management and data access seriously. That usually involves a careful stacking of:

  • Local component state for UI details (dropdown open/close, form inputs).
  • Global application state using tools like Redux, Zustand, or React Context for shared business data and user session details.
  • Server state management with libraries like React Query or SWR for fetching, caching, and synchronizing data with backends.

These layers allow dashboards to provide:

  • Real-time updates using websockets or streaming APIs for time-sensitive KPIs.
  • Offline resilience and graceful degradation when connectivity is poor.
  • Optimistic UI where user actions feel instant, even before the server confirms changes.

Every one of these details matters in a business context. When an operations team sees inventory counts update live, or when a financial controller can filter complex transactions without latency, they are experiencing the accumulated benefits of good state architecture and frontend engineering discipline.

Performance and Perceived Speed

React’s virtual DOM and component-based approach are powerful, but they are not magic bullets. High-performance dashboards require explicit attention to:

  • Bundle size optimization (code splitting, lazy loading, tree shaking) so that large dashboards load quickly.
  • Memoization and rendering strategies to prevent unnecessary re-renders when data changes frequently.
  • Efficient data queries that retrieve only what is needed, avoiding overfetching.

This is particularly crucial for dashboards that are heavy on charts, maps, and tabular data. Performance is not just a UX consideration; it affects adoption and trust. If executives or operational staff perceive a dashboard as slow or unreliable, they revert to spreadsheets and manual reporting. A well-optimized React dashboard directly influences whether the organization truly becomes data-driven.

Security, Role-Based Views, and Compliance

Business dashboards often expose sensitive information: financials, personal data, intellectual property, or operational secrets. Modern frontend architecture has to incorporate robust client-side security patterns, even while recognizing that true protection lives in backend authorization.

But the frontend is instrumental in:

  • Enforcing role-based UI, showing or hiding menu items and sections based on permissions.
  • Preventing accidental data exposure through careful routing and access guards.
  • Supporting auditability with interfaces that log changes and make history traceable.

In regulated industries (finance, healthcare, public sector), the alignment between frontend capabilities and compliance rules can make or break a digital initiative. A mature React architecture anticipates these constraints early, rather than patching them on at the end.

Data Visualization and UX of Insight

A React dashboard is not merely a canvas for charts; it is the medium through which insight is communicated. Good dashboard UX pays attention to:

  • Information hierarchy: What do users need to see first? What belongs in drill-down views?
  • Contextual cues: Tooltips, annotations, and thresholds that make numbers meaningful.
  • Interaction flows: How users filter, compare, or segment data without getting lost.

When a business treats UI/UX as equal partners to data modeling, dashboards become more than reporting tools; they become operational control centers. React’s ecosystem of charting libraries (such as Recharts, Victory, or D3-based wrappers) gives teams the flexibility to build highly tailored visualizations that align with specific workflows.

Scalability Across Products and Teams

As companies grow, they often end up with multiple web applications: customer portals, internal admin tools, analytics hubs, partner dashboards, and more. Without a coherent frontend strategy, these products diverge in design, technology, and quality. That leads to duplication, usability problems, and increased maintenance cost.

A React-based, component-driven architecture can serve as a unified foundation across all these products. Shared component libraries, style guides, and layout patterns ensure that each new project reuses the best of what already exists. This is where design systems and UI frameworks specifically tailored to React give organizations long-term leverage.

The Strategic Role of Consulting and Specialized Frameworks

Building a robust, modern frontend platform and sophisticated dashboards is not trivial. It demands architectural foresight, design system thinking, and a deep understanding of the business domain. Many organizations recognize that trying to invent everything from scratch slows them down and introduces unnecessary risk. This is where specialized UI frameworks, patterns, and consulting services come into play.

When teams look into Modern Front-End Development with XUI and ReactJS Consulting, they are typically seeking to accelerate this journey. Rather than spending months debating folder structures, component patterns, or state management strategies, they prefer to adopt battle-tested approaches and tooling from experts who have solved these problems repeatedly.

Why Structured Consulting Matters

React’s flexibility is both a blessing and a curse. There is rarely one “right” way to structure an application, and popular libraries evolve rapidly. Teams often get stuck in decision paralysis or, worse, make ad-hoc choices that lead to a tangle of incompatible patterns over time. Consulting helps organizations do the following:

  • Clarify architectural goals: Identify whether the priority is speed to market, long-term maintainability, customization, or all of the above.
  • Select suitable technologies: Choose the right routing, state management, data fetching, and UI frameworks for the specific context.
  • Define coding standards: Establish linting rules, testing strategies, and naming conventions that keep large teams aligned.
  • Mentor internal teams: Upskill in-house developers so they can continue building confidently once the consultants step back.

Instead of treating consulting as a short-term patch, forward-thinking businesses see it as a catalyst that helps them reach a self-sustaining, high-velocity frontend culture faster.

The Role of XUI and Design Systems

UI frameworks and design systems like XUI (or similar component libraries) encapsulate best practices for layout, typography, components, and interaction patterns. When aligned with React, they provide a consistent, production-ready starting point for building dashboards and applications.

A mature design system typically includes:

  • Foundations such as color palettes, spacing scales, typography, and iconography.
  • Base components like buttons, inputs, modals, and tooltips with accessible default behaviors.
  • Compound components such as tables, charts, sidebars, and step-by-step wizards.
  • Usage guidelines describing when and how each component should be used for consistent UX.

Aligning React development with a system like XUI allows businesses to:

  • Launch new dashboards faster, because core elements are already implemented.
  • Reduce UX drift across teams and products.
  • Improve accessibility and responsiveness by default, rather than as afterthoughts.

Consulting around such systems helps teams adopt them effectively, extend them when necessary, and avoid anti-patterns that compromise maintainability.

Domain-Driven UX and Workflow Mapping

Not all dashboards are created equal. A sales performance dashboard, an IoT monitoring console, and a healthcare analytics portal each have distinct workflows, mental models, and constraints. Generic UI patterns rarely deliver optimal value without domain adaptation.

Effective consulting engagements dig deeply into:

  • Stakeholder roles: Who uses the dashboard and for what decisions or tasks?
  • Frequency and urgency: Are users glancing at KPIs daily, or performing intensive data investigations?
  • Error and risk profiles: What are the consequences of misinterpreting a chart or clicking the wrong button?

This domain analysis then guides the structuring of pages, navigation, filters, and visualizations. For example:

  • Operations teams may need alert-first dashboards that highlight anomalies above all else.
  • Financial analysts may need dense, multi-dimensional grids with complex filters and export capabilities.
  • Executives may prefer summary views with trends and narratives rather than raw tables.

React and frameworks like XUI provide the toolbox, but consulting aligns that toolbox with real-world workloads and business goals.

Governance, Collaboration, and Developer Experience

As frontend teams grow, governance and developer experience become key success factors. Without clear guidelines, even the best architecture degrades over time. Consulting-supported modernization efforts often include:

  • Monorepo or multi-repo strategies for managing shared libraries and services.
  • CICD pipelines that automate linting, testing, bundling, and deployment.
  • Documentation practices like Storybook or internal portals where components and patterns are cataloged.

The outcome is a smoother collaboration between designers, developers, product managers, and QA. Friction is reduced, and teams can focus on solving business problems rather than re-litigating basic tooling choices.

Balancing Customization with Maintainability

One of the dangers of powerful UI frameworks and React’s flexibility is over-customization. Every product team may be tempted to create bespoke components and one-off solutions for their specific needs. Over time, this leads to:

  • Duplicated logic and UI behavior.
  • Inconsistent look and feel across applications.
  • Higher bug surface area and regression risks.

A disciplined approach, often reinforced by external experts, establishes clear rules for when teams can deviate from the base system. Some practices that help include:

  • Requiring architectural review for new component patterns.
  • Maintaining a central component library where improvements are contributed back instead of forked locally.
  • Tracking design debt and periodically aligning variant components.

This balance allows sufficient flexibility for innovation while preserving the long-term integrity of the frontend ecosystem.

Future-Proofing: From SPA to Microfrontends and Beyond

Modern frontend architecture does not stand still. Single Page Applications (SPAs) remain common, but many organizations now explore:

  • Server-side rendering (SSR) and static generation to improve SEO and initial load performance.
  • Microfrontends to allow independently deployable UI modules across teams or business units.
  • Hybrid architectures that mix multiple rendering strategies based on use case.

React continues to be at the center of many of these patterns. What changes is the deployment and composition model. Expert guidance helps organizations avoid premature complexity while still laying the groundwork for future scaling. For example, even if microfrontends are not immediately necessary, designing with isolated, self-contained components today can ease that transition later.

Conclusion

Modern frontend development has become a core business capability, not just a technical concern. React-based dashboards transform complex data into meaningful, actionable experiences when supported by sound architecture, performance optimization, and careful UX design. Frameworks and design systems like XUI, combined with specialized consulting, help organizations accelerate this transformation while preserving maintainability and consistency. By investing strategically in their frontend stack, businesses position themselves to build scalable, insight-rich, and future-ready digital products.